Applelicious Cupcakes
Cream Cheese Filling
1 8 ounces package cream cheese
1/4 cup butter, softened
1/2 cup sugar
1 large egg
2 tablespoon flour
1 teaspoon vanilla
Apple batter
1 cup finely chopped pecans
3 cups flour
1 cup of sugar
1 cup firmly packed light brown sugar
2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1 teaspoon nutmeg
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on ground allspice
3/4 cup canola oil
3/4 cup apple sauce
1 teaspoon vanilla
3 cups peeled Gala apples, finely chopped
Praline Frosting
1/2 cup firmly packed light brown sugar
1/4 cup butter
3 tablespoon milk
1teaspoon vanilla
1 cup powdered sugar
Prepare Filling: Beat the first three ingredients at medium speed with an electric mixer until blended and smooth. Add egg, flour, and vanilla beat until combined.
Prepare Batter: Preheat oven to 350. Bake finely chopped pecans in a shallow pan 8-10 minutes until toasted. Stir together flour and the next seven ingredients in a large bowl; stir in eggs, and follow with the oil, apple sauce, and vanilla until dry ingredients are moistened. Stir in apples and pecans.
Spoon batter into cupcake lined pans, filling half. Then spoon about 1/8 cup of cream cheese filling using all the filling. Top with remaining batter.
Bake 20-25 minutes until a wooden tester comes out clean.
Makes 24 cupcakes
Prepare Praline Frosting: Bring brown sugar, butter, milk to a boil in a 2-qt saucepan over medium heat, whisking constantly. Boil one minute. Remove from heat, add vanilla, stir. Gradually whisk powder sugar until smooth. Stir for 3-5 minutes until frosting slightly thickens. Before the frosting is cool, frost cupcakes. Top with chopped pecans and one dried apple chip.
